California Court Blocks Kars4Kids Advertisements Over Deceptive Marketing Practices

Transparency Concerns in Charity Promotions Spark Legal Action

The familiar Kars4Kids campaign,known for its catchy jingle and widespread recognition across North America,has been prohibited from broadcasting in California following a judicial decision. The court found the charity’s advertisements to be misleading under the state’s false advertising regulations.

These commercials often feature children singing the memorable tune while urging viewers to donate thier vehicles. Though, questions about how donations are actually allocated have cast doubt on the organization’s messaging.

Donor Litigation Uncovers Misleading Portrayal of Charitable Goals

A lawsuit filed by Bruce Puterbaugh, a retired craftsman from California, brought these issues into sharp focus. After donating a 2001 Volvo XC valued at $250 USD with the expectation that his gift would aid disadvantaged youth nationwide,he discovered that most funds were directed toward Oorah-a Jewish institution-rather than directly supporting local underprivileged children as implied by Kars4Kids’ ads.

Judge Gassia Apkarian of California superior Court highlighted that Oorah’s programs include activities such as matchmaking services for young adults and gap year trips to Israel for teenagers aged 17 and 18. These initiatives differ substantially from customary charitable efforts aimed at alleviating poverty among youth.

Kars4Kids Faces Criticism From Charity Evaluators

The charity’s long-standing presence on Canadian airwaves has also drawn scrutiny. Charity Intelligence Canada assigned Kars4Kids its lowest rating-a single star-citing insufficient transparency regarding how donor contributions are spent and concerns over accountability.

“A one-star rating from Charity Intelligence should serve as a warning sign for donors,” emphasized Kate Bahen, managing director of the watchdog group. “There are more reliable charities worthy of support.”

Lack of Transparency in Fund Distribution Raises Questions

Kars4Kids’ Canadian branch did not clarify whether donations collected domestically benefit Canadian children specifically. Their website indicates affiliation with Oorah Charitable Organization-a registered non-profit recognized by Canada Revenue agency (CRA) but primarily focused on religious and educational programs rather than direct poverty relief.

Financial Disclosures Reveal Spending priorities

The most recent CRA filings show that during fiscal year ending May 31, 2025, Oorah transferred roughly $12.6 million CAD internationally to projects based in Israel and Texas-including institutions like Texas Torah Institute and Cincinnati Hebrew Day School.

Total expenditures reported by Oorah reached $19 million CAD for 2024-25; notably $3.7 million was dedicated solely to marketing campaigns instead of direct charitable services or community aid programs.

Kars4Kids Issues Statement Amid Controversy

A spokesperson representing Kars4Kids Canada asserted their independence from U.S.-based operations via email correspondence concerning California’s ban on their advertisements: “the court ruling is fundamentally flawed; it overlooks critical facts and misapplies legal standards.”

“We remain confident we will succeed upon appeal given both legal precedent and evidentiary support.”
